Businesswoman Ho Ching Is Stepping Down

The Singaporean Prime Minister’s wife, Ho Ching, has been Chief Executive Officer of investment company Temasek Holdings for the last 17 years, but will retire in October. Under her watch, the company has grown its portfolio and has been transformed from a Singapore-focused firm into one of Asia’s most active state investors…

Michelle Obama Has Not Rested

While Michelle Obama is widely known as the first African American First Lady of the United States, she is also a lawyer, writer, and has over the years become a role model for many women around the world. Born in 1964, she studied sociology and African American studies at Princeton University in New Jersey before graduating from Harvard Law School in 1988…

Cynthia Marshall Has Broken Barriers Several Times

Not only was Cynthia Marshall the first Black cheerleader at the University of California, Berkeley, but a few years ago she also became the first Black female Chief Executive Officer in the NBA. A lifelong pioneer, she is familiar with facing challenges. Growing up in the housing projects of Richmond, California…
